Transaction 99ed685bbcdf77791811b3c103b37c614bbc7af35363d1722417e12d0a26855f

1 Input
2 Outputs
  • 99ed685bbcdf77791811b3c103b37c614bbc7af35363d1722417e12d0a26855f:0
  • value  199249
    address  372BjESAr5q3adEPL1KZ7dwtkZyxU63maX
  • 99ed685bbcdf77791811b3c103b37c614bbc7af35363d1722417e12d0a26855f:1
  • value  60506010
    address  35X5n3thgGoTSbjZoUbugpt7hH7KRvr8mQ